Types of PVC kitchen cabinets

At present, PVC kitchen cabinets are made using two types of PVC boards – PVC hollow boards and PVC foam boards. The empty board is affordable and light in weight, and true to its name, it is hollow. In contrast, PVC foam boards have the ability to be thicker, resulting in increased durability compared to hollow boards.

PVC Hollow Boards

PVC hollow boards

PVC hollow boards have an empty interior and are known for their greater flexibility. They are not only lighter but also more cost-effective than the other option. Regrettably, this kind comes with some drawbacks. Their thermal resistance is low and they are not resistant to termites, moisture, or fire. PVC foam boards are more durable compared to them.

PVC foam boards

PVC foam boards may be pricier, yet they possess numerous favorable characteristics. Hollow boards are not as thick, wide, or long-lasting as solid boards. They are also protected from heat and may occasionally need precise finishing touches. Foam board PVC kitchen cabinets are more durable and sturdy, making them a superior choice for your kitchen cabinet layout.

PVC Cabinet Characteristics

Characteristics of a PVC kitchen cabinet design

Consider opting for foam boards when selecting PVC kitchen cupboard designs. This is because hollow boards typically do not withstand heat or fire, therefore they can result in sturdy cabinets. Foam boards, on the other hand, are usually made to withstand heat and fire rather well. In addition, it is thought of as a non-toxic, chemical- and corrosion-resistant substance. This guarantees hygienic handling of your food.

PVC installation process

An important benefit of PVC is how easy it is to install. It comes in pre-made boards that typically don't need additional finishing touches. PVC comes in various colors and does not require laminates or additional enhancements to appear attractive. Because of its lightweight nature, it is also simple to manipulate. Nonetheless, proper expertise is needed for installing PVC foam boards, as incorrect finishing could lead to permanent damage to the cabinet.

The steps in the installation process are as follows:

1 Measure the space:

Before installing PVC cabinets, make sure to properly measure and prepare the kitchen space for the cabinets. Take out any current cabinets, appliances, and fixtures that could disrupt the setup process.

2 Choose the cabinet design:

After measuring the space, you can select the PVC kitchen cabinet design that fits your requirements the most. PVC cabinets are available in a range of colors, designs, and textures to complement the decor of any kitchen.

3 Assembly:

Assemble the separate cabinet units of modular PVC cabinets according to the manufacturer's instructions during installation. This could include connecting the sides, shelves, doors, and hardware using screws or other types of fasteners.

4 Mounting:

Start by placing the lower cabinets initially, beginning at one side of the kitchen and moving towards the other side. Before attaching the cabinets to the wall and floor, make sure they are straight and level using a level tool.

5 Hanging wall cabinets:

After positioning the base cabinets, proceed to mount the wall cabinets on top of them. Utilize a stud finder to find the wall studs and fasten the cabinets to the wall with screws. Ensure that the cabinets are horizontally straight and correctly positioned with the lower cabinets.

6 Finish the installation:

Once the cabinets have been set up, you can enhance them by including finishing touches such as hardware, trim, and lighting. This will provide a refined and professional appearance to your contemporary PVC kitchen cabinets.

Can You Paint PVC Kitchen Cabinets?

Yes, you are able to paint your PVC cabinets. However, there are a few key points you should be aware of prior to getting started. Regular latex paint does not adhere well to the PVC surface. If it adheres, it likely can be easily scraped off.
